In 2008, he moved to PGE Skra Bełchatów, one of the most successful teams in Polish PlusLiga, where he quickly became a key player. With PGE Skra he won the Polish Championship three times in 2008/2009, 2009/2010 and 2010/2011 and claimed a silver medal in 2011/2012. He won Polish Cup three times - in 2009, 2011 and 2012. He also has two silver medals of Club World Championships from 2009 and 2010. In 2010 PGE Skra Belchatów, with Bartosz Kurek, won the bronze medal of CEV Champions League. On March 18, 2012 PGE Skra won the silver medal of CEV Champions League after losing to Zenit Kazan in the final in Łódź, Poland. The final result was judged controversial by some, as the referee didn't see an error by a Russian player and ended the match despite the fact that the audience and the players saw the error on screen. Kurek received the award for Best Spiker of CEV Champions League 2011/2012.
